Absorption of longitudinal ultrasonic waves in polymer solution (polymethyl methacrylate)

Abstract
Measurements of the change of absorption coefficient of longitudinal ultrasonic waves were carried out over the temperature range from I0°C to 50 °C in a 2% solution of polymethyl methacrylate in benzene irradiated with intense ultrasonic waves. The ultrasonic absorption measurements were performed by the pulse technique at frequencies of 2.5, 4, and 6 MHz. A marked change in absorption coefficient was observed as the temperature, and intensity of ultrasonic waves increased. A qualitative discussion is given on the assumption that the structural changes induced by intense ultrasonic waves, as well as by the temperature are related to changes in the number of degraded groups in the polymeric network.
